About Pascale Gaudet
Pascale Gaudet is a scholar working on Biophysics, Endocrinology and Molecular Biology, having authored 69 papers that have together received 3.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Bioinformatics and Genomic Networks (31 papers), Biomedical Text Mining and Ontologies (30 papers) and Genomics and Phylogenetic Studies (14 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Molecular Biology (2.2k citations), Aging (55 citations) and Cell Biology (362 citations). Pascale Gaudet has collaborated with scholars based in Switzerland, United States and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Suzanna Lewis, Paul D. Thomas, Michael Livstone, Petra Fey, Rex L. Chisholm, Huaiyu Mi, Anushya Muruganujan, Qing Dong, Karen E Pilcher and Amos Bairoch. Their work appears in journals such as Nucleic Acids Research, Journal of Biological Chemistry and Nature Genetics.
